The Department of General Medical Practice of Semey, under the leadership of Professor A.A. Dyusupova, regularly organizes events in schools in Semey dedicated to a healthy lifestyle, sexual education, metabolic syndrome prevention, and other health-related topics.
As part of this initiative, a preventive medical examination was conducted at Secondary School No. 3 in Semey with the participation of intern doctors from Group 601 of the General Medical Practice Department and faculty members O.A. Yurkovskaya, G.T. Kamasheva, and T.M. Belyaeva. During the examination, the following procedures were carried out:
✔ Vision and hearing check-ups
✔ Measurement of height, weight, and blood pressure
✔ Vaccination according to the National Immunization Schedule
✔ Educational discussions on healthy nutrition and the prevention of infectious diseases
